Know how to style curly hair
There are certain practices you can follow to manage and style your curly hair in the best possible manner.
Pat dry wet hair using a soft towel instead of rubbing hair strands vigorously. This is the most important step if you do not want your curly hair to become all frizzy and dry. Detangle curly hair using a wide-toothed comb to prevent accidental breakage.
If your curly hair is fine and thin, you can use a volumizing product to get that ultimate volume, shine, and smoothness. Use sulfate-free shampoos and conditioners
Curly hair is essentially dry and more prone to damage than other hair types. So, you need to be extra careful about the shampoo and conditioner you are using to cleanse and condition this kind of tresses. Opt for shampoos and conditioners that are devoid of sulfates and come enriched with antioxidants, vitamins, and hydrolyzed keratin. This way, you will be able to preserve the youthful look of your curly hair strands for a longer time.
Bear in mind that there are no hair products created for curly hair, as there are no cleansing or conditioning ingredients that are specific to curly hair. You would be better off in opting for products that are formulated to treat damaged or thin hair instead.
Do not over wash curly hair strands
Curly hair tips are not limited to knowing about the best products suitable for this particular hair type. You would also have to be aware of the washing and conditioning regimen to increase the manageability, volume, and fullness of your curly hair.
Do not wash your curly hair too often to prevent your hair strands getting all dry and rough with time. This is true for all other hair types as well. Shampooing too often along with the associated activities, such as towel drying of the hair strands, blow drying of the wet hair, and brushing, can lead to more damage than you might have bargained for.
Use the shampoo more on the scalp to cleanse your hair follicles of product build up. This concentration of the shampooing on the scalp would also prevent dryness of individual hair strands.
Condition curly hair with care
There is usually a particular way to condition curly hair for best results. Apply the conditioner you have selected only to the length of the hair strands. Avoid applying it near the scalp to prevent the product from weighing down the hair strands at the scalp and making this part of your hair appear flat and unimpressive. Once applied, make sure to leave on the conditioner for as long as possible for the best moisturizing effects on your tresses.
